基于虚拟力的自组织覆盖算法

基于虚拟力的自组织覆盖算法

ID:40197003

大小:218.50 KB

页数:3页

时间:2019-07-25

基于虚拟力的自组织覆盖算法_第1页
基于虚拟力的自组织覆盖算法_第2页
基于虚拟力的自组织覆盖算法_第3页
资源描述:

《基于虚拟力的自组织覆盖算法》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、第36卷第14期Vol.36No.14计算机工程ComputerEngineering2010年7月July2010·网络与通信·文章编号:1000—3428(2010)14—0093—03文献标识码:A中图分类号:TP301.6基于虚拟力的自组织覆盖算法邹磊,蔡自兴,任孝平(中南大学信息科学与工程学院,长沙410083)摘要:针对随机部署的无线传感器节点,提出一种基于虚拟力的自组织覆盖算法。将排斥力、引力、边界约束力这3种虚拟力作用于网络中的每个节点,使聚集在一起的节点分散开,引入节点间距离的阈值、边界节点与边界距离的阈值实现

2、对感兴趣区域的最大覆盖。实验结果表明,该算法在保证连通性的基础上有效扩大了覆盖区域,具有较强实用性。关键词:无线传感器网络;虚拟力;区域覆盖Self-organizationCoverageAlgorithmBasedonVirtualForceZOULei,CAIZi-xing,RENXiao-ping(SchoolofInformationScienceandEngineering,CentralSouthUniversity,Changsha410083)【Abstract】Thispaperpresentsaself-org

3、anizationcoveragealgorithmbasedonvirtualforceaimingattheWirelessSensorNetwork(WSN)nodeswhicharerandomlydeployed.Itutilizesthreekindsofvirtualforcesincludingrepulsiveforce,gravityandborderconstraintforceapplytoeachnetworknodetoseparatetheaggregatenodes,introducesthethre

4、sholdamongnodesandthethresholdbetweennodeandbordertorealizemaximizecoverageoftheinterestedarea.Experimentalresultsshowthatthisalgorithmcanvalidatecoverageareaeffectivelyonthebaseofensuringconnectivity,andithaswellutility.【Keywords】WirelessSensorNetwork(WSN);virtualforc

5、e;areacoverage1概述无线传感器网络(WirelessSensorNetwork,WSN)[1]是综合传感器技术、嵌入式技术、信息处理技术和无线通信技术的一个新兴计算机科学技术研究领域。由于不需要预先架设固定的基础设施,因此WSN具有部署快、灵活度高、抗毁性强等特点,特别适用于军事战场、受污染环境等危险区域。同时在生物医疗、智能家居、城市交通、空间探索等领域都具有潜在的使用价值。无线传感器网络节点的部署方式分为确定性部署和自组织部署2种。在一些未知或存在危险的环境中,确定性地部盖算法。2基于虚拟力的自组织覆盖算法2.1

6、基本模型定义传感器节点通常是随机散步在待监控区域内,存在大量的重复覆盖区域使得传感器节点不能充分发挥作用[5]。在SOCVF中,一个感兴趣区域中的每个节点都受到区域中其他节点的力的作用,如果节点之间的距离小于预先设定的阈值dbth,则这个力使这些节点相互排斥,使得节点不会聚集重复覆盖一个子区域。记一个节点Sj对Si处的作用力为Fij,则节点S受到的作用力合力为F,即ii署节点是不切合实际的,通常只能采取随机布置节点的方式,n在这种方式下,节点一般通过自组织部署达到对感兴趣区域Fi=åj=1j¹iFij(RegionOfInter

7、est,ROI)的覆盖。本文提出基于虚拟力的自组织覆盖算法(Self-OrganizationCoveragealgorithmbasedonVirtualForce,SOCVF)可以使随机放置的传感器节点对感兴趣区域的覆盖最大化。文献[2-3]指出,随机部署的每个节点都受到3个虚拟力的作用:(1)障碍物的排斥力;(2)由覆盖度引起的引力,引入这个力是为了保证节点不至于隔得太远,而使得对感兴趣区域达到一定的覆盖度;(3)节点之间的作用力。在文献[2-3]中,节点之间不直接通信,而是通过簇头来通信,所有信息都通过簇头来转发。文献[4]

8、提出一种分布式覆盖算法。在该算法中假设随机部署的节点都知道自己的位置信息,引入一个节点密度的概念来计算节点之间的虚拟力。本文综合以上2种算法的思想,提出基于虚拟力的自组织覆记节点Si(x,y)的邻居节点定义为jcL={"(S(x',

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。